How Can You Troubleshoot Common DHCP Issues Effectively? Are you experiencing issues with devices not obtaining IP addresses on your network? In this detailed video, we’ll walk you through effective methods to troubleshoot common DHCP problems. We’ll start by explaining what a DHCP server is and how it manages IP address assignments across your network. You’ll learn how to verify if the DHCP service is running correctly and what steps to take if it’s not. We’ll also cover how to check the DHCP scope, ensuring there are enough available addresses and that no conflicts exist. Additionally, we’ll discuss the importance of proper server configuration, including network bindings and port usage, to keep everything running smoothly. If your network uses relay agents, we’ll show you how to confirm they’re reachable and functioning properly. We’ll also demonstrate how to monitor network traffic using tools like Wireshark to identify where the DHCP process might be breaking down. Plus, we’ll talk about how rogue DHCP servers can interfere with your network and how to detect and disable them. Finally, we’ll cover common issues like IP conflicts and incorrect DHCP options that can prevent devices from accessing the internet. By following these steps, you’ll be able to resolve most DHCP-related problems efficiently and keep your network operating seamlessly.
